Using the magnets as SWCLK and SWDIO should be a very neat way to make the watch wearable whilst keeping SWD available for debugging and disaster recovery. The idea is to run thin wires from the SWD pins to the backs of the magnets and then carefully drill access holes from the other side so pogo pins can make contact with the magnet casing. There's probably some static risk but if a very find drill bit is used the risk should be pretty minimal.
